The projector wont show video in powerpoint presentation?

G

Guest

I have inserted video clips into a powerpoint presentation. It plays fine on
the laptop but when I try to use a projector all I get is a black window. I
have tried to change the video clips to different formats but the results are
the same. Is there a way I can do this?

Hey Austin,

I've found that 9 out of 10 times this is fixed by "shortening the path" as
you've documented on
http://www.playsforcertain.com/tuto...hite_screen_with_no_video_but_the_sound_plays:

and it works regardless of OS or PPT version.

Apparently the MCI Player will play the video on extended desktop, so
following the flow chart documented here is a good way to force it:
http://msdn2.microsoft.com/en-us/library/aa168133(office.11).aspx

BTW,
downloading and installing the latest WMP and turning back graphics
acceleration also has a pretty good success ratio.
